I'm getting ready to re-install the stainless side rails on my Bally Playboy, and I have an alignment question. Should I center the button holes with the cabinet holes, or align on a back or front edge?

I've got the nail in ones from pinball life.

Attach your flipper housing and use that for your guide. The cabinet looks really nice.

#3 3 years ago

You should install the plastic rails/guides for the glass before re-installing the rails.

I use small wood screws and not nails, and it is a lot easier if you ever need to remove the rails.

You already have the hole drilled for the carriage bolt, just in front of the flipper button. This will only allow you to install it in one location. You will have very little adjustment after this is put in. So start with the single carriage bolt, and the rest will line up.

#5 3 years ago

Even though the Flipper button and the carriage bolt may line up, other holes may not line up perfectly. This is true if you go with replacement rails (new).
I noticed that the positions of the holes is not exactly the same one. So, you just have to drill some new pre-holes and screw or nail accordingly.
